Mohawk Styles: From Subtle to Extreme
A mohawk is an iconic hairstyle that's been rocking the scene for centuries. It involves shaving the flanks of your head while leaving a strip of hair in the middle, styled to impressive heights. From tasteful trims to outrageous spikes, there's a mohawk style for every individual.
For those seeking a more discreet approach, consider a mini mohawk. This involves keeping the shaved area closer to the scalp and styling the center strip in a structured fashion. It's a perfect choice to add a touch of attitude without going full-on punk rocker.
On the other hand, if you're ready to go all out, there are endless possibilities for an extreme mohawk. Think sky-high spikes, vibrant dyes, and even add-ons. This is a statement piece that will definitely turn eyes and make you the center of attention.
The Evolution in the Mohawk
The Mohawk hairstyle has a rich and fascinating history, evolving over centuries from practical to symbolic to trendsetting. Originating with the Haudenosaunee people of North America, it served both ceremonial and protective purposes. Early Mohawks often featured intricate designs with colorful feathers, reflecting tribal affiliations and individual status. As colonization spread, the Mohawk took on new meanings, becoming associated with resistance against oppression. By the mid-20th century, the hairstyle had gained mainstream popularity, embraced by musicians, actors, and fashion icons alike. Today, the Mohawk remains a versatile style of individuality, adaptable to countless variations and reinterpretations.
